My goal is to get the word out and to get more people to think and to help. Most obviously, you see things about fundraising- surgery for a hurt animal, money for a sanctuary, funds for a local shelter. All things that I support and contribute to.
What about what doesn't cost anything? Signing a petition. Participating in a local fundraiser. Being a foster (most charities pay for food and vet expenses). Watching a friend's pet. Volunteering. Spreading the word about animals in need through social media.
